South Shillong students receive monetary aid

SHILLONG, March 22: Students from 19th South Shillong Constituency have received a monetary aid of Rs 50,000, sanctioned under discretionary grant 2022-23, from local MLA Sanbor Shullai.
A statement in this regard informed that the aforesaid students have been selected by the Meghalaya Wushu Association (MWA) to represent the state at the ‘21st Sub-Junior National Wushu Championship’, which will be held from March 25-30 in Tamil Nadu.
